Bio 12 Chapter 12 Environmental Geology and Earth Resources …
Because of tectonic movements, Europe and Africa are drifting slowly toward the Americas. When continental plates collide with continental plates, both plates usually subside. When oceanic plates collide with continental plates, the continent usually rides up over the seafloor. Because of tectonic movements, India is moving away from China.

Shoreland Management
The water levels of the Great Lakes change over short and long periods of time. During a low water period large beaches form and wetland vegetation may expand, during high water periods beaches and dunes erode and bluffs may fall into the lake. By giving our coasts the space to change, we can protect our shorelands for generations to come.

Which statement is true about sand and baking soda? Both …
Sand is typically a heterogeneous mixture because it is composed of various types of small particles that are not chemically bonded together and retain their separate identities. Furthermore, sand often contains disparate materials such as quartz, minerals, and organic matter, each with distinct properties.

Critical Dune Areas Program
The Sand Dunes Program began in 1976 when concern for the impacts of sand mining on the dunes led to the passage of the Sand Dune Protection and Management Act. This statute regulated the sand mining industry in Michigan's designated critical dune areas, by requiring plans for sand removal and re-stabilization after the mining operation was complete.
